How to fill out scope of services

How to fill out scope of services
01
Start by understanding the purpose and objectives of the project.
02
Identify the key stakeholders who will be involved in the project.
03
Define the boundaries and scope of the project.
04
Determine the specific deliverables and services that need to be addressed in the scope.
05
Describe each service in detail, including its purpose, timeline, and any specific requirements.
06
Clearly outline the responsibilities and roles of each stakeholder in relation to the services.
07
Include any limitations or exclusions that should be considered as part of the scope.
08
Review and revise the scope of services document with input from all relevant stakeholders.
09
Obtain approval and agreement on the final scope of services document.
10
Use the scope of services document as a guide throughout the project to ensure that all included services are delivered as intended.
Who needs scope of services?
01
The scope of services is needed by project managers, business analysts, consultants, contractors, and any individual or organization involved in planning and executing projects. It helps to define and communicate the expectations, boundaries, and responsibilities related to the services provided.

What is scope of services?
The scope of services outlines the specific tasks, responsibilities, and services that are to be provided within a particular project or contract.
Who is required to file scope of services?
Typically, contractors, service providers, or organizations that engage in the delivery of specific services under a contractual agreement are required to file the scope of services.
How to fill out scope of services?
To fill out the scope of services, clearly define the services being provided, outline the objectives, deliverables, timelines, and any relevant terms and conditions. Ensure to include all stakeholders involved.
What is the purpose of scope of services?
The purpose of the scope of services is to establish clear expectations regarding the work to be performed, ensuring both parties understand their roles and responsibilities to prevent any misunderstandings.
What information must be reported on scope of services?
The information that must be reported includes a detailed description of services, timelines, deliverables, responsibilities of both parties, terms and conditions, and any specific project requirements.
